How can derivatives be used to hedge an investment?

0

A hedge is an investment that is specifically made to reduce or cancel out the risk in another investment. Derivatives allow risk in an underlying asset to be offset. When the underlying asset loses money, the derivative position gains money and vice versa. Therefore, the combined position of the underlying asset and the derivative contract will be less risky.
